Index of /_SITEIMAGE/view/c2hvcC1waGluZi5wc3RhdGljLm5ldA/95/81/a6/83
Name
Last modified
Size
Description
Parent Directory
-
9581a6835a714605541a..>
2024-10-17 22:57
43K